About this role
Waymo's AI Foundations team seeks a software engineer to integrate large-scale foundation models into autonomous driving production systems. You'll adapt models across new sensors and platforms while collaborating with cross-functional teams to deploy next-generation capabilities for the Waymo Driver.
What you'll do
- Connect large-scale foundation models with production autonomous driving systems
- Adapt foundation models to support new sensors, vehicle platforms, and production requirements
- Collaborate with multiple teams to integrate and land foundation models on next-generation platforms
- Solve complex system-level problems in large-scale deployments
- Work on LLM/VLM integration and deployment pipelines
- Support safe autonomous operation across diverse driving conditions and environments

Waymo
Waymo develops autonomous driving technology and vehicles, building the AI systems, simulation platforms, and infrastructure that power the Waymo Driver. The company is hiring for ML infrastructure engineers, platform engineers, labeling system developers, backend software engineers, and automotive systems engineers to scale its autonomous driving capabilities.
